Description and references
Volatile oil from dried ripe kernels of bitter
almonds or from other kernels containing amygdalin, such as apricots,
cherries, plums, and especially peaches. Obtained by macerating with
water, then steam distilling. Constit. Not less than
95% benzaldehyde; 2-4% HCN and phenoxyacetonitrile.
Properties
Colorless to yellow, very refractive liq; characteristic
odor and taste of benzaldehyde. d2525 1.038-1.060. nD20 1.5428-1.5439. Slightly sol in water; miscible with alcohol, ether, oils.
Keep cool and protected from light.Caution
Hydrogen cyanide,
q.v., component responsible for highly toxic properties.
Very poisonous!Use
Only the oil
free from HCN may be used
for liqueurs and foods.
Therapeutic Category
Formerly as topical antipruritic.
